At Barnett Waddingham, we are currently recruiting a new and exciting opportunity for a Central Service Secretarial Team Manager to join our Secretarial business area.
The role of our Secretarial Services hub area is to provide central and dedicated secretarial administration to all business areas, employees, and Partners at Barnett Waddingham.
This Central Service Secretarial Team Manager position is responsible for managing all central service team members, located across various BW offices.
The successful candidate will have a considerate and holistic approach to leadership, with a desire to bring out the best in people.
As the Central Service Secretarial Team Manager, you will have several years' experience working in a similar role and have previously managed teams.
Responsibilities
First point of contact for all internal client Central Service secretarial enquiries, responsible for managing the design of business solution and distribution of workflow amongst the team.
Leads weekly huddle meetings to ensure all team members are aware of responsibilities and activities of the team.
Host PDRs with each direct report.
Provides coaching and arranging training where necessary.
Carry out regular onsite visits to all offices every six weeks.
Actively manages the team to achieve goals and respond to the needs of the business.
Support, Implement and Maintain Information Security procedures and activities in accordance with BW's Information Security Policy.
Creates monthly impact report, outlining people, process and service achievements and performance.
Contribution to the preparation of the Secretarial Service hub vision plans and budget reviews.
Working with Secretarial Services Management team to design and arrange annual away days, quarterly knowledge and engagement sessions, monthly communication plans.
Provides shadow cover for other Secretarial Service Team Managers and undertakes necessary professional development and training to achieve best practice in role.
